How do I share my Internet connection with more than one computer - January 30, 2007

2007-01-30: If you have a broadband connection to the Internet (DSL service or a cable modem), then you already have a fast enough connection to share with multiple computers... You can share your Internet connection with more than one computer by using a device called a "router." The router forwards traffic from the Internet to the computers "behind" it on your private home network or Intranet... How does this work... Wireless Versus Wired Routers ...

How do I set the user's home page with JavaScript - January 29, 2007

2007-01-29: In Internet Explorer 6.0 and earlier, it was possible to change the user's home page with JavaScript... How It Used To Work ... Until Internet Explorer 7.0, it was possible to do it via JavaScript code, like this: But this is no longer permitted in Internet Explorer 7.0... The Best Workaround Today ... The best workaround is to give your users instructions on how to manually set the home page...

How does Google make money - January 17, 2007

2007-01-17: Google "gives away" a great search engine, among other features... In a nutshell: advertising revenue... Google is a major player in the online advertising industry... In addition, you may have noticed columns or boxes containing similar text-link ads on other websites - such as this one - which say "Ads by Google" at the top...
